A leader in autonomous driving since 2007, Torc has spent over a decade commercializing our solutions with experienced partners. Now a part of the Daimler family, we are focused solely on developing software for automated trucks to transform how the world moves freight.

As a Software Engineer on the ML Ops Framework & Conversion team, you will own the pipelines that take models from research to production on edge hardware, including model conversion, compilation, benchmarking, and release. Our team is comprised of engineers with deep expertise in ML and RL frameworks, embedded systems, and autonomous driving — united by a focus on getting models from development into the real world reliably and at scale.
The ML Ops Framework & Conversion team is responsible for the full model conversion process — from architecting TensorRT pipelines to maintaining the model release registry across platforms. In this role, you will work closely with perception and safety teams to ensure every model that ships meets strict latency and accuracy requirements for autonomous trucking.
